The US House Financial Services Committee passed a Republican resolution.
The US House Financial Services Committee voted to pass Republican-led Congressional Review Act resolutions, including one led by Rep. Andy Barr that would block a cap on credit card late fees, proposed by the Consumer Financial Protection Bureau (CFPB).
The move reflects an increase in Republican efforts to overturn Biden administration financial policies, but the resolutions are unlikely to become law as Republicans lack the votes to override a veto from President Biden.
